Hvordan løse "Ugyldig feltdatatype (Feil 3259)" Problem i MS Access

Finn ut hvorfor du kan få svaret "Ugyldig feltdatatype (Feil 3259)" i MS Access og hva du kan gjøre når du kommer over en slik melding.

Hvordan løse "Ugyldig feltdatatype (Feil 3259)" Problem i MS Access

Du kan ikke ønske unna kjøretidsfeil. Dette er fordi de aldri forsvinner med mindre de er fikset. Hvis du ønsker å oppdatere databasen din og ikke kan fortsette på grunn av feilen ovenfor, bør du vurdere en av tilnærmingene som er forklart nedenfor, og fikse problemet først før du fortsetter.

En nærmere titt på kjøretidsfeil 3259 i MS Access

Ugyldig feltdatatype (feil 3259)

Som du kanskje har gjettet, oppstår denne feilen når du prøver å oppdatere et felt i en databasetabell med en annen datatype enn den som allerede er definert. Det er relatert til hvordan databasen sorterer data som legges til i ulike felt. Datatypen til et felt er definert under designfasen av en database. Brukere kan oppdatere databasefelt manuelt eller bruke skript. Databaseutviklere må teste hver komponent i databasen for å sikre at kjøretidsfeil utløses til rett tid.

Årsaker til at denne feilen utløses

For en database som fungerer som den skal, bør oppdatering av et felt med feil datatype utløse denne feilen. Men hvis sorteringsrekkefølgen endres etter at databasen er opprettet, vil feilen utløses. Det er lurt å vurdere versjonene av MS Access som tarfå brukere av en database vil ha. Dette er fordi visse sorteringssekvenser ikke støttes av tidligere versjoner av MS Access. Å åpne en 2010 Access-database i Access 2007 kan derfor forårsake denne feilen.

Derfor er det viktig å gjøre deg kjent med databasesorteringsrekkefølgefunksjoner som er tilgjengelige i nyere versjoner av MS Access før du bruker dem på databaser som vil kjøre på eldre versjoner av applikasjonen. Denne tilnærmingen vil hjelpe deg med å håndtere problemer med bakoverkompatibilitet knyttet til sorteringssekvenser i MS Access.

Denne feilen kan også skyldes korrupte Access-databaser, på grunn av malware-angrep, eller feil på maskinvare/programvare som henholdsvis minne og grafikkdrivere. Når dette skjer, kan ulike innstillinger på databasen din, inkludert sorteringssekvenser, bli ødelagt og utløse feilen ovenfor.

Slik løser du dette problemet

Før du starFor å fikse problemet, utelukk maskinvare- og programvareproblemer ved å åpne andre Access-filer på datamaskinen. Hvis databasen kjører uten problemer, vend oppmerksomheten mot Access-filen. Som en forholdsregel anbefales det å installere en versjon av MS Access som er kompatibel med databasen din.

Under de generelle innstillingene velger du riktig sorteringsrekkefølge for databasen. Komprimer og reparer nå databasen for å fullføre prosessen. Dette Tilgang reparasjon prosedyren er mulig hvis databasen ikke har noen korrupsjonsproblemer og når du kjenner den første sorteringssekvensen satt av utvikleren. Ellers må du være kreativ og få en plan som fungerer.

Den enkleste måten er å gjenopprette databasen ved å bruke en kopi av en sikkerhetskopifil som fungerer. Men hvis du ikke har en sikkerhetskopi, kan du velge å opprette en tom database og importere objekter fra den berørte filen. Denne tilnærmingen kan fungere for databaser med mindre korrupsjonsproblemer.

I tilfeller der filen har store korrupsjonsproblemer, bruk DataNumen Access Repair verktøy for å gjenopprette databasedataene dine. Når alle filene er gjenopprettet, importerer du dem til en ny database.

DataNumen Access Repair

Legg igjen en kommentar

Din e-postadresse vil ikke bli publisert. Obligatoriske felt er merket *